Eligible Immigrant Voters in the USA Reaches Record Level

Over 23 million immigrants in the United States will be allowed to vote in the 2020 presidential election, equaling around a tenth of the country’s overall electorate According to the Pew Research Center, this is a record high. The total of immigrants eligible to vote has risen at a steady pace by 93 percent over …

America’s Economy Has Been Growing for a Record 10 Years

Watching the US economy over the past ten years makes the old saying ring true: “Expansions don’t die of old age”.  As of December 2019, there has been expansion of the US economy for 126 straight months, making it the longest stretch in the country’s history, according to the National Bureau of Economic Research. American Employers Added 266,000 New Jobs in November 2019

Hiring in the U.S. increased in November 2019 to the highest rate since January of the same year and wages increased over three percent. Employers paid no attention to trade conflicts and a worldwide slowdown and added 266,000 positions. In October, the unemployment rate dropped from 3.6 percent to 3.5 percent, matching a 50-year low, …

Most New Tech Jobs in the USA Are in These Five Metro Areas

The economic benefits tech jobs bring are being concentrated in several cities in the United States, said a report by The Brookings Institution and the Information Technology and Innovation Foundation. Boston, San Jose, San Francisco, San Diego, and Seattle are the five metro areas accounting for 90 percent of all growth in the tech sector. …
